WestBridge Capital is a private equity house that typically invests in profitable, fast growing UK SMEs with enterprise values of £10m to £20m.
The partners approached us in 2010 after they had raised an investment fund of £50m (no mean feat given the economic conditions at the time).
They wanted us to put them on the radar of corporate finance professionals, management teams, institutional and private investors, with the message that they were ‘open for business’ and had money to invest.
Media relations, drafting award entries and email marketing have been our core routes to market.
